Ecuador deploys 75,000 soldiers and police to combat drug gangs
AI Summary
Ecuador has deployed 75,000 soldiers and police across its most violence-prone provinces as part of an intensified campaign against drug gangs. The government has declared it is effectively 'at war' with the criminal organizations. The large-scale security operation reflects the severe deterioration of public safety in the country.
Citizens of the most violent-wracked provinces have been warned the government is "at war" with the gangs.
